About Licensing Law in Cebu City, Philippines

Licensing Law in Cebu City is a critical part of business operations. It involves obtaining the necessary permits and following regulations related to doing business in the city. This can range from registering a business name to acquiring permission for business activities. The city's government requires these licenses to ensure that all businesses adhere to the standard practices and local ordinances. Without a proper license, a business could face penalties, including closure. It is therefore highly advised to understand licensing requirements in Cebu City and abide by them.

Local Laws Overview

In Cebu City, there are key local laws relevant to business licensing. These cover aspects like the necessary permits, payment of appropriate fees, and compliance with specific local regulations. A zoning clearance certificate, business permit, and occupancy permit are typically required. Businesses also need to pay annual taxes and undergo regular inspections to ensure compliance. The city government strictly implements these regulations to maintain order and to ensure safety. Breach of these laws can lead to penalties and potentially, business closure.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. How are licensing fees calculated in Cebu City?

Business licensing fees in Cebu City are generally determined based on the type and size of the business. Consult local ordinances or a licensing lawyer for detailed information.

2. What penalties could I face for non-compliance?

Non-compliance penalties range from fines to business closure, depending upon the severity of the violation and the specific local law violated.

3. How often will I have to renew my business license?

In Cebu City, business licenses typically need to be renewed annually.

4. Can I operate my business while my license application is still in process?

Generally, businesses are not allowed to operate until all necessary permits and licenses are approved and obtained.

5. Can a business license be transferred if the business changes ownership?

Typically, new owners will need to apply for a new license as licenses are usually not transferrable.

Additional Resources

The Cebu City government website is a useful source of information. The Business Permit and Licensing Office (BPLO) under the City Treasurer's Office is the primary office responsible for business licensing. Professional associations, such as the Cebu Chamber of Commerce, can also provide resources and assistance.
